Senior Manager, Product Marketing

Hybrid Full TimeNew York, New York, United StatesBrooklinen

At Brooklinen, we’re building the future of comfort — thoughtfully, ambitiously, and with intention — nurturing our customers, our team, and the work that helps us grow in a way that feels human and sustainable.

Requirements

  • Define Product Positioning & Narrative
  • Establish clear, differentiated positioning across key categories (bedding, bath, etc.)
  • Translate product features into compelling, customer-first value propositions
  • Define who each product is for by identifying target customer cohorts and use cases
  • Develop cohort-specific messaging and descriptors that make product fit immediately clear to the customer
  • Build consistent product storytelling frameworks that scale across site, email, paid, and retail
  • Lead Go-to-Market Strategy
  • Own GTM strategy for product launches and key commercial moments
  • Partner with Product and Merchandising to shape how products are brought to market not just when
  • Ensure launches have clear messaging, audience definition, and success criteria
  • Drive alignment across teams so launches are executed with clarity and consistency
  • Shape Product Content Strategy (in partnership with Ecommerce)
  • Define the messaging and content strategy that powers PDPs and performance channels
  • Partner with Ecommerce, who owns testing and conversion outcomes, to:
  • Evolve PDP messaging and product education
  • Inform testing priorities and hypotheses
  • Translate performance insights into clearer, more effective storytelling
  • Leverage Customer & Market Insight
  • Develop a deep understanding of customer motivations, behaviors, and purchase drivers
  • Analyze competitive positioning and identify opportunities to differentiate
  • Use insights to inform product messaging, launch strategy, and future opportunities
  • Drive Cross-Functional Alignment
  • Act as a connector across Product, Merchandising, Creative, Ecommerce, and Performance teams
  • Bring structure and clarity to how product stories are developed and executed
  • Strengthen alignment between product creation, brand expression, and customer demand

Benefits

  • Up to 100% medical, dental, and vision coverage
  • Fertility & family-building support
  • 401(k) with a 4% company match
  • 16 weeks fully paid parental leave
  • 20 vacation days (25 after 5 years) plus year-round Summer Fridays
  • Hybrid work schedule with two core in-office days
  • Remote Thanksgiving week and remote last week of December
  • Up to four additional remote weeks per year with approval
  • 40% employee discount plus seasonal product allowance
  • One Medical, Talkspace, and $1,000 per year via Joon for wellness
  • One-month paid sabbatical after five years
